Reminds me in some ways of the Surlyfest....I think the hops may be similar or the same but both lean heavy on the hops for this style.

A-Looks the part....Rich burnt orange....nice white head that laces...nice clarity.

S-A tantalizing gooey caramel begins the experience and is quickly followed by a tangerine, grapefruit citrus element. My guess is there are some Summit hops being used in this as it has that "feel" to it...very mild garlic/onion notes known to the Summit hops..

T-Leans more toward the hops than the malt...citrus notes of grapefruiit rind and freshly squeezed tangerines. Malt is big on the caramel..no toasted malt evident.

M-Medium bodied....dry finish....

D-Decent enough if you like a hoppy marzen....not your typical marzen...different but decent...
